一种新型直流旋风分离器

摘    要:针对普通旋风分离器结构上存在有内旋流和混流区会卷走尘粒而降低分离效率的问题 ,总结了原直流旋风分离器生产设计经验 ,开发设计出了一种新型直流旋风分离器 ,没有普通旋风分离器存在的两个问题 ,而且能克服普通旋风分离器流动路线长的缺陷 ,在同一工作条件下 ,分离粒径比原直流旋风分离器减小了 6~ 8μm。在此介绍了分离机理 ,提出了一套设计计算方法 ,给出了计算实例 ,总结出新型直流旋风分离器的特点及适用场合

A NEW TYPE OF DIRECT CURRENT CYCLONE SEPARATOR

Abstract:This paper was dirceted against the structure of the original cyclone separator with inner whirl current and mixed current area removing dust granule to reduce separate efficiency.Summing up the manufacturing and designing experinece of the original D.C. cyclone separator,a new type of D.C. cyclone separator was designed without the two problems of the original one,getting rid of the defect of the original one whose separating particle diameter was 6~8 μm smaller than that of the original one.This paper briefly introduced a separating mechanism of the new type of D.C. cyclone separator,offered a design calculation method and a calculating instance,also summed up the characteristics of the new type of D.C. cyclone separator and its applications.
